What are the factors that affect coal tar production in rammed coke ovens?
http://bbs.hcbbs.com/viewthread.php?tid=468575
The most direct one is the proportion of bituminous coal and coking coal to be added. When these two types of coal are used in large quantities, the volatile matter content increases, which in turn results in more gas production. As a consequence, there is also a greater amount of by-products such as tar, benzene, toluene, ammonia, and so on. . However, too much coke leads to a decrease in strength.
It is mainly related to the volatility of the coal fed into the furnace and the temperature in the roof space of the coke oven
1. In terms of the formula, the main change is in the coal mix; there is a clear increase in gas-rich and fertilizer-coal, as well as an increase in tar content. 2 The process of tar production mainly relies on temperature control. 3. The recovery of tar relies on reducing the temperature (by spraying ammonia water and using a pre-cooler), which causes the tar and ammonia water to combine ; Secondly, electrostatic tar collectors are used to remove tar dust. When these two substances are drawn to the \"large vessel,\" ammonia and tar are separated

In addition to the reasons mentioned above, the low tar yield when producing coke is also related to the height of the coal cake; if the height of the coal cake is not sufficient, the tar yield will decrease as well
